Author:
Mr. Seitz is the founder and the Managing Director of Seitz Consulting, LLC. His firm specializes in
strategic financial planning, emerging business services and business valuation matters. In addition to
providing assistance to both debtors and creditors for bankruptcy and troubled debt restructuring matters,
the firm provides litigation support and forensic analysis assistance including expert testimony on a wide
range of financial and accounting issues.
He has served as an expert witness in the litigation of various business cases including net lost profit and
damage determinations, business valuations, accounting and auditing issues, as well as other complex
financial matters. Additionally, he has been appointed by the Delaware Chancery Court to serve as the
forensic accountant for business disputes. He is experienced in the areas of troubled debt restructuring
and bankruptcy. In addition to his experience on Delaware bankruptcy cases, he has served Committees
of Unsecured Creditors for bankruptcies in Baltimore, Maryland and Houston, Texas. He has testified in
Delaware Chancery and Superior Courts, United States District Court in North Carolina and in the
Houston Bankruptcy Court. The diverse clientele he has served includes closely-held businesses, hightech
and service companies, nonprofit organizations, real estate and financial services companies,
including broker/dealers and banks, manufacturing operations, racetracks and publicly-held clients with
multinational operations.
Mr. Seitz enjoyed a long career with the international accounting firm Price Waterhouse where he was an
audit partner. In addition to being the partner in charge of the firm’s Wilmington Office, he maintained
client service responsibilities serving a diverse group of small and large businesses. As a member of the
firm’s Entrepreneurial Services Group, he gained substantial expertise in assisting emerging middlemarket
businesses with various management challenges including business planning, financing
alternatives and incentive programs for employees. He was also a member of the firm’s Law Firm
Services Group and testified and participated in various litigation engagements. Mr. Seitz was also a
senior member of the Litigation and Bankruptcy Services Group of Deloitte & Touche LLP as well as a
founding member of a regional accounting firm where he was in charge of the financial reporting,
litigation and valuation services areas of the firm.
Mr. Seitz has also served on the Boards of Directors of two financial services companies and held senior
management positions including Senior Executive Vice President and Chief Financial Officer with those
organizations. He was responsible for the legal affairs of each organization charged with overseeing and
formulating the legal strategies for all litigation. He is experienced in regulatory and legislative matters
having interfaced extensively with the Federal Deposit Insurance Corporation and the Delaware Office of
the State Bank Commissioner and various state and federal elected officials.
Mr. Seitz is a Certified Public Accountant in Delaware and Pennsylvania and Accredited in Business
Valuation (ABV) as well as a Certified Valuation Analyst (CVA) and Certified Forensic Financial
Analyst (CFFA). He has authored various articles on accounting and bankruptcy issues and law firm
management. Mr. Seitz has also been an instructor for Loscalzo Associates a firm providing continuing
education courses for CPAs nationwide. An active member of the community, he serves on the Boards of
several nonprofit organizations, including the United Way of Delaware. Mr. Seitz has also served as
President of both the Delaware State Board of Accountancy and the Delaware State Society of CPAs as
well as the Middle-Atlantic Director of the National Association of State Boards of Accountancy. Mr.
Seitz is a graduate of the University of Delaware and has been honored as the University’s Outstanding
Alumnus and also received the College of Business and Economics’ Annual Award of Excellence.
